Hotel Forest Inn launches IPO, applications open for migrant workers
The company has allocated shares worth Rs 40 million for migrant workers, issuing 400,000 ordinary shares at a face value of Rs 100 per share. Eligible investors can apply for a minimum of 10 shares and a maximum of 200,000 shares until January 22.

Pokhara Airport serving 2,000 passengers a day
Pokhara Airport serving 2,000 passengers a day
POKHARA, Jan 14: Pokhara Airport has been serving an average of 2,000 passengers on a daily basis. About a quarter of total passengers are foreigners.

UAE giving $10m in subsidized loans to generate energy from waste
UAE giving $10m in subsidized loans to generate energy from...
KATHMANDU, Jan 13: The United Arab Emirates (UAE) has decided to provide Nepal with US$ 10 million (approximately Rs 1.13 billion) subsidized loan for the generation of electricity from urban waste.
